What companies run services between Bristol, England and Coleraine, Northern Ireland?

There is no direct connection from Bristol to Coleraine. However, you can take the bus to Public Transport Interchange, walk to Bristol Airport (BRS) airport, fly to Belfast International Airport (BFS), walk to Belfast International Airport, take the bus to Antrim Buscentre, walk to Antrim, then take the train to Coleraine. Alternatively, you can take a train from Bristol Temple Meads to Coleraine via Newport (S Wales), Holyhead, Holyhead Ferry, Dublin Ferryport B+I, Dublin Connolly, and Belfast Grand Central in around 14h 44m.
